Hi, I’m Arielle!

I am an organic mixed-media artist, alt market creator/coordinator, photographer & dabbler in travel/tourism content creation.

I started in photography as a hobbyist landcape and nature photographer and after 10+ years, I have transitioned to the human-ish realm. I have a deep passion for creative/fantasy photography, probably because my nose is always in fantasy novels and my brain is always oozing with weird ideas. I have always known photography as a healing modality but after my first ever boudoir experience (as the muse), I discovered the release, rebirth and remembrance held by photography.

Before immersing myself in my creative endeavors, I worked in the water quality field. I received my diploma in Water Engineering Technology and worked for years in this industry. I will always be a passionate environmentalist and water quality nerd, I have just channeled that passion through a different expression.

My top priority during our session together is to hold a non-judgmental, brave space that allows my clients to feel empowered. I work very hard to create a trauma-informed environment that is fluid throughout all my sessions, whether that be a nature portrait, creative/fantasy or an intimate, boudoir session.

The art I craft is inspired by the natural world, incorporating crystals, preserved florals, plants, insects, wood, stone and other organic materials. Each piece is unique and honours a different story of nature. Organic materials are sourced ethically and as locally as I can. Supporting my community and local environment is vital to both my personal values, as well my business values.
